Mongo.Context.MongoMetadata.GetQualifiedTypeName C# (CSharp) Method

GetQualifiedTypeName() static private method

static private GetQualifiedTypeName ( string collectionName, string resourceName ) : string
collectionName string
resourceName string
return string
        internal static string GetQualifiedTypeName(string collectionName, string resourceName)
        {
            return UseGlobalComplexTypeNames ? resourceName : string.Join(WordSeparator, collectionName, resourceName);
        }

Usage Example

Example #1
0
        public ResourceType ResolveResourceType(string resourceName, string ownerPrefix = null)
        {
            ResourceType resourceType;
            var          qualifiedResourceName = string.IsNullOrEmpty(ownerPrefix) ? resourceName : MongoMetadata.GetQualifiedTypeName(ownerPrefix, resourceName);

            this.instanceMetadataCache.TryResolveResourceType(GetQualifiedPropertyName(MongoMetadata.RootNamespace, qualifiedResourceName), out resourceType);
            return(resourceType);
        }